Responsibilities & Accountabilities:
Product Management:
- Collaborate with the Director of Product Management to define and execute the product roadmap, aligning it with company goals and customer needs
- Executes category direction by working closely with cross functional product teams (innovation, operations, sales, marketing)
- Creates & owns product lifecycle roadmaps and manages accordingly for product launches including execution of post line review feedback
- Product Authority for all product and packaging specifications, pricing, plant packaging specs, program set up sheets and Supply Chain communications on product specs
- Manages the launch of sold-in products, in collaboration with the Sales Teams and Supply Chain team to deliver quality, competitive, products to customer shelf
- Builds and maintains assortment plans for complete product channel management
- Provides direction for POG development as required
- Be the point of contact for the Sales Team for Product deliverables
- Monitor product performance metrics post-launch and gather feedback to inform future product iterations.
- Regularly communicate product updates and progress to the Director of Product Management and other stakeholders, ensuring alignment with overall business objectives.
Product Launches:
- Champions the Product Launch process & presentation to Sales complete with new product knowledge training, samples, sales marketing collateral and channel marketing strategy
- Owns and maintains the Sales Kit working closely with Design & Packaging teams to build marketing collateral to ultimately provide superior sales tools.
- Drives new product knowledge training across Sales Teams, Customer Service & European teams, as required
- Owns and manages the completion and maintenance of category PriceLists
Market Insights:
- Performs market store Comp Shops, compiles competitive product specification and retail price data and builds market landscape reports.
- Creates market analysis reports such as Gap Analysis, Retail Price Ladders.
- Identify opportunities for product enhancements and new features.
